Best regards, Tor Rune Skoglund, [email protected] Den 27. feb. 2014 20:52, skrev Rob Godfrey: > For completeness... the Java Broker would hold a single image in memory and > and on disk (no matter how many queues the message went to)... though it > probably wouldn't be able to allocate a mesage that was over 4Gb as it > would attempt to allocate a single byte array of that size - and Java is > limitted to 4Gb there because it uses signed 32-bit integers for array > access. We've never had anyone try to use such large messages, and I must > admit I'm curious as to why you would want to bundle up all your data into > a single message rather than chunking it into smaller units. > > -- Rob > > > On 27 February 2014 20:36, Ted Ross <[email protected]> wrote: > >> Speaking for the C++ broker: >> >> If the messages are transient (i.e. not durable), the enqueued messages >> will all be a reference to a single in-memory instance of the message >> content.
